Poinciana's Palmetto Elementary School serves grades PK-4 in the Polk district. Based on its state test results, it has received a GreatSchools Rating of 3 out of 10.

Palmetto Elementary School is a public school in the Polk school district located in Poinciana, FL. The principal of Palmetto Elementary School is Mr. Edgar Santiago. As of 2015, the students are 66.6% Hispanic; 18% Black, non-Hispanic; 11.8% White, non-Hispanic; 1.4% Multiracial; 1.2%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ander; 0.9% Asian; and 0.1% Native American or Native Alaskan. 65% of students are participating in a free or reduced-price lunch program. 26.1% of students are english learners.
